Alan M. Carroll resolved TS-982.
--------------------------------
Resolution: Fixed
Changed to use ink_inet_ip4_set which handles the issue. However, checking the
original code it looks like the API expects host order input. I added comments
to the header to make this clear.

> TSHttpTxnClientAddrGet provides malformed sockaddr_in

> It looks like PluginVCCore::set_passive_addr() and set_active_addr() never
> set the address family. And the address and port look like they are getting
> byte swapped.
